mysql - 如何根据用户为特定会话设置 block_encryption_mode?
问题描述
我正在尝试根据用户设置特定于会话的块加密模式,但在此命令上出现错误:
IF(SELECT CURRENT_USER()) = 'root'
THEN SET SESSION block_encryption_mode = 'aes-256-cbc'
END IF;
您的 SQL 语法有错误;检查与您的 MySQL 服务器版本相对应的手册,以在第 1 行的 'SELECT CURRENT_USER()) = 'root' THEN SET SESSION block_encryption_mode = 'aes-2' 附近使用正确的语法
我该如何解决这个问题?
解决方案
推荐阅读
- php - PHP中的字符串数组(检查2个或更多字符串是否具有相同的开头)
- cmake - Apache Thrift 编译 C++ 服务器
- webpack - 用 webpack-dev-server 收听地址?
- python - 在 MPII Human Pose 数据集上训练 Keras 分类器
- javascript - ThreeJS:如果 r95 中存在 TransformControls,则 OrbitControls 不起作用
- javascript - 为什么这会返回一个空数组?
- video - 从 Granicus 下载视频
- iis - 简单的 WebAPI 路径在 localhost 中有效,但在 IIS 8.5 中无效
- amazon-web-services - 在 cloudinit 中设置用户定义的主机名
- arrays - 我需要使用 Array 将数据从 UITableViewController 传递到 UIViewController